## Changelog — Ticktrace 1.9

### Renamed: DRIFT_API_TOKEN
During the cron drift investigation we found plugins confusing this variable with the metrics token, so it has been renamed to indicate it authorizes drift-report uploads specifically. Plugin authors must read the new name from 1.9 onward; the old name is ignored without warning. Sample env files in the SDK are updated. In your deployment env file, the drift-report upload secret is set on the next line.

env line for fawef-taguf: VAULT_KEY13=a9695905a9a90

The Pondera SDKs for Korr and Veld now have full feature parity as of v4.2: batch uploads, webhook verification, and cursor pagination behave identically in both. Remaining differences are cosmetic (naming conventions only). Plugin authors should target the shared interface spec rather than either SDK directly. Both SDKs authenticate against the internal Gatepost service; parity test fixtures require a valid credential. For sandbox verification, use the key below.

app token of bahaf-tajeg = zpat23_SjjsllwiLmXbtS65veZaV47

Welcome aboard — a note on this change to the Fernwheel dependency graph visualizer. Layout cost grows roughly quadratically with edge count, so we clamp node expansion and defer label rendering past a zoom threshold. Please keep these limits in the shared constants module rather than inline; the current values are as follows.

tuning table, yajog-yahof:
BUDGETS = {
    "lamvan": 303,
    "wenox": 460,
    "fenvan": 525,
}